Dessert Story is the perfect way to end off dinner at any of the restaurants at Kingsway. Service is super quick and courteous and they have to be because they have to keep the turnover going or it would get super crowded.
Mouthwatering Taiwan and Hong Kong desserts are so refreshing and delicious. I particularly like their Snow Series but bring a friend along because these servings are huge. If I can't convince someone to share with me I get their Mango Sago pudding with green tea ice cream. Hubby loves the sea coconut sago in coconut milk.
The prices are very reasonable considering that down the road you'd pay the same price for a small piece of over rich cake. Here you'd get a good size bowl of refreshing and not too sweet deliciousness.
I'd like to be able to recommend more of their offerings but the ones I've tried are so yummy that I keep going back for the same things. Their menu has about 100 different options not counting their extensive drinks menu.
Pop in between 12 noon and 3pm Monday to Friday for 15% off anything on the menu.

This chain offers a variety of TW and HKG desserts and milk tea. Prices are reasonable and they have 15% off for Happy Hour (Mon-Fri) which is good for working people to have a treat. The best i'd recommend is the Taro Ball series with yam and red beans (whether cold or hot), it's yummy!
